Ventura’s 3-bedroom apartment market is a dynamic landscape shaped by a confluence of factors, including location, affordability, and local economic conditions. This analysis explores the current trends, price comparisons, and key drivers influencing this segment of the Ventura housing market.

Average Rental Prices

The average rental price for a 3-bedroom apartment in Ventura is influenced by factors such as location, amenities, and the overall housing market. While precise figures fluctuate, a recent study by Zillow indicated that the average rent for a 3-bedroom apartment in Ventura ranged from $3,000 to $4,000 per month. This figure is significantly higher than the national average, reflecting the high demand for housing in Ventura County.

Comparison with Nearby Cities

Comparing Ventura’s 3-bedroom apartment market with neighboring cities provides valuable insights into regional trends. According to recent data from Apartments.com, the average rent for a 3-bedroom apartment in Oxnard is around $2,500 per month, while in Santa Barbara it averages $4,500 per month. This suggests that Ventura offers a middle ground in terms of affordability compared to these neighboring cities.

Types of 3-Bedroom Apartments in Ventura

Ventura’s 3-bedroom apartment options cater to a range of lifestyles and preferences. The most common types include:

  • Traditional Apartments: These are typically located in multi-unit complexes, often offering amenities like swimming pools, laundry facilities, and assigned parking. They can range from modest to upscale, with varying levels of square footage and modern finishes.
  • Townhouses: Offering more space and privacy, townhouses feature multiple levels, private entrances, and often include a small yard or patio. They are popular for families seeking a more independent living experience.
  • Condominiums: Condominiums provide a blend of apartment living with ownership benefits. Residents own their unit but share common areas like fitness centers, pools, and community rooms. Condominiums are often located in newer buildings with upscale finishes.
  • Single-Family Homes: While less common for rentals, some single-family homes in Ventura are available for lease, providing the most space and privacy. These homes often have larger yards and may offer unique features like garages or detached studios.

Essential Questions for Potential Landlords

Before making a decision, it’s crucial to ask specific questions to assess the suitability of a property and the landlord’s professionalism:

  • Lease terms and conditions: Clarify the lease duration, rent amount, deposit requirements, and any renewal policies.
  • Pet policies: Inquire about pet restrictions, breed limitations, and any associated fees.
  • Utilities and amenities: Determine which utilities are included in the rent and the availability of amenities like parking, laundry, and common areas.
  • Maintenance and repairs: Understand the landlord’s responsibilities for maintenance, the process for reporting issues, and the timeframe for repairs.
  • Background checks and credit history: Ask about the landlord’s screening process for tenants, including credit checks and criminal background checks.
  • Security deposit and refund process: Confirm the amount of the security deposit, the conditions for its refund, and the timeframe for receiving it.
  • Parking and storage: Inquire about available parking spaces, assigned or unassigned, and the availability of storage units.
  • Noise levels and neighborhood environment: Ask about the general noise level in the building and the surrounding neighborhood to ensure compatibility with your lifestyle.
  • Building rules and regulations: Review any building rules and regulations, such as guest policies, noise restrictions, and pet guidelines.

Navigating the Rental Application Process

The rental application process in Ventura is competitive, requiring promptness and thoroughness:

  • Complete the application promptly: Submitting a completed application promptly demonstrates your interest and increases your chances of being considered.
  • Provide accurate and complete information: Ensure all information on the application is accurate and complete, including contact details, employment history, and financial information.
  • Gather necessary documents: Prepare the required documentation, such as proof of income, photo ID, and rental history, to support your application.
  • Pay application fees: Be prepared to pay any non-refundable application fees, as these are often required to process your application.
  • Follow up with the landlord: After submitting your application, follow up with the landlord to inquire about the status and estimated timeframe for a decision.

Securing a Lease for a 3-Bedroom Apartment

Once you’ve been approved, securing a lease involves several steps:

  • Review the lease agreement: Thoroughly review the lease agreement before signing, paying close attention to the terms, conditions, and responsibilities of both parties.
  • Pay the security deposit and first month’s rent: Be prepared to pay the security deposit and the first month’s rent as Artikeld in the lease agreement.
  • Schedule a move-in inspection: Before moving in, schedule a move-in inspection with the landlord to document the condition of the apartment and note any existing damage or issues.
